Transaction d63bd79aed1ca11cf0f33c001d6a3c8e405565f444061b57fa23521c617866fe
1 Input
1 Output
-
d63bd79aed1ca11cf0f33c001d6a3c8e405565f444061b57fa23521c617866fe:0
- value
- 73291
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 eb8154d9df9e714c52e258eeb8a949b6f05df5da98f44664154797e2a2329ce5
- address
- bc1pawq4fkwlnec5c5hztrht322fkmc9maw6nr6yveq4g7t79g3jnnjsvn63lj